New Delhi: Former England all-rounder Andrew Flintoff is trending big time on Twitter after he compared Virat Kohli with Joe Root, following which Amitabh Bachchan gave him a fitting reply. (ICC World T20: FULL COVERAGE | SCHEDULE)
As the cricket fraternity praised Kohli's stupendous knock against Australia in ICC World Twenty20, Flintoff too joined in and posted the following tweet.
At this rate @imVkohli will be as good as @root66 one day ! Not sure who @englandcricket will meet in the final now ! — andrew flintoff (@flintoff11) March 27, 2016
Big B, who seems to be closely following the tournament, didn't take much time in replying to Flintoff's Tweet.
@flintoff11 @imVkohli @root66 @englandcricket Root who ? जड़ से उखाड़ देंगे Root ko ..!!! — Amitabh Bachchan (@SrBachchan) March 27, 2016
That was not the end of the banter as Flintoff tagged Mr Bachchan's tweet with the following message.
Sorry who's this ? https://t.co/sjhs7HGT1d
— andrew flintoff (@flintoff11) March 27, 2016
While the Bollywood legend posted no more tweets to Flintoff, a fan, who runs Ravindra Jadeja's parody account on Twitter (@SirJadeja), replied with the following tweet.

Flintoff, who was criticised by several Indian fans for trolling Amitabh Bachchan, later said that people don't get the tongue-in-cheek humour.
Getting a taste of what it is like to be @piersmorgan ,some abuse flying about ,some people just don't understand the term "tongue in cheek" — andrew flintoff (@flintoff11) March 27, 2016
